Adaptive finite element methods based on flux and stress equilibration using FEniCSx

Abstract

This contribution shows how a-posteriori error estimators based on equilibrated fluxes - H(div) functions fulfilling the underlying conservation law - can be implemented in FEniCSx. Therefore, dolfinxeqlb is introduced, its algorithmic structure is described and classical benchmarks for adaptive solution procedures for the Poisson problem and linear elasticity are presented.
